Concrete foundation repair services involve assessing and fixing issues with the base structure that supports a building. Over time, foundations can develop cracks, settling, or shifting due to soil movement, moisture changes, or other environmental factors. Skilled service providers evaluate the extent of the damage using specialized techniques and then perform repairs such as sealing cracks, underpinning, or reinforcing weakened areas. These repairs are essential for maintaining the stability and safety of a property, preventing further damage, and preserving its value.
Many common problems indicate the need for foundation repair. These include visible cracks in walls or floors, doors and windows that no longer close properly, uneven or sloping floors, and gaps around window frames or door jambs. Such issues often suggest that the foundation has shifted or settled unevenly. Addressing these problems promptly can help prevent more serious structural concerns, such as wall bowing or severe settling, which can be costly to fix and may compromise the property's safety.
Foundation repair services are typically used on residential properties, including single-family homes, townhouses, and small apartment buildings. They are also relevant for some commercial properties with concrete foundations. Homes built on expansive clay soils, those experiencing moisture fluctuations, or properties with older foundations are more prone to issues that require repair. The overview below groups typical Concrete Foundation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Holt, MI.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or foundation repairs, such as crack sealing or small piers, generally range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, though prices can vary based on specific conditions. Fewer projects tend to reach the higher end of this spectrum.
Moderate Fixes - More involved repairs like underpinning or partial foundation stabilization often cost between $1,000 and $3,500. These projects are common for homeowners experiencing noticeable settling or cracking. Larger or more complex fixes can push costs above this range.
Full Foundation Repair - Complete foundation repairs, including extensive underpinning or wall reinforcement, typically range from $4,000 to $10,000. Many local contractors handle projects in this tier, although larger or more complex jobs can exceed $15,000.
Full Replacement - Replacing an entire foundation in Holt, MI, can cost $20,000 or more, depending on size and scope. These are less frequent but represent the highest end of typical foundation repair costs handled by local service providers.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s that a concrete foundation needs repair? Signs include visible cracks, uneven floors, doors or windows that stick, and gaps between walls and floors, indicating potential foundation issues that local contractors can assess.
How do professionals typically repair foundation problems? Repair methods may involve underpinning, piering, or sealing cracks, depending on the severity and type of foundation damage, which local service providers can determine.
Can foundation issues be prevented or minimized? Proper drainage, consistent maintenance, and addressing minor cracks early can help reduce the risk of major foundation problems, with local contractors offering guidance on preventative measures.
What types of foundations are most common in Holt, MI? The area commonly features poured concrete slabs and basement foundations, both of which can be repaired by local pros experienced with these types.
